 Basic playback
This function is used to playback recorded data. This unit 
allows recorded data to be played back using various 
methods. The basic playback described below is the most 
common method for playback.
step
1.  Press the PLAY button inside of the front door.
• Playback starts.
•  After turning the power on, the oldest recording  
data is played back first. Otherwise, playback 
resumes at the stopped position of the previous 
playback spot.
STOP
PAUSE REV. PLAY PLAY
JUMP TO END
SPEED
 When the “Playback Device Repeat Setting” is set to 
“Repeat Off,” playback stops when reaching the physical 
end of the HDD or end point of the recording section. 
When the “Playback Device Repeat Setting” is set to 
“Repeat On,” recorded data is played back repeatedly. 
(System Menu   Memory   Recording Data Readout 
Setting)
[To change the playback device:]
step
2
-1
. Select the playback device and playback area in the 
<Select Source Device>. (User Menu   Search)
 Main: Plays back the contents from the main HDD 
device.
Normal: Normal recording area
Alarm: Alarm recording area
LPA: Long pre-alarm recording area
 Copy 
1: Plays back the recorded contents of the 
copy 1 device.
  “SerialBus,” “DVD/CD,” “USBmemory”
 Copy 
2: Plays back the recorded contents of the 
copy 2 device.
  “Internal,” “SerialBus,” “DVD/CD” 
 “Alarm” appears when “Alarm Recording Area” is set 
to other than “0 %.” (System Menu   Memory   Data 
Management Setting for Main Memory)
 “LPA” appears when “Long Pre-Alarm Area” is set to 
other than “0 %.” (System Menu   Memory   Data 
Management Setting for Main Memory)
step
2
-2
. Press the PLAY button.
•  Playback of the selected device starts.
 When you press the PAUSE/JUMP TO END button during 
the playback is stopped, the still frame playback picture 
around the end point of the latest recording is displayed.
step
3.  To pause playback, press the PAUSE button.
•  To resume playback, press the PAUSE button 
again or press the PLAY button.
step
4.  To stop playback, press the STOP button.
•  When executing playback again, the playback 
starts from the stopped position of the previous 
playback.
 Pressing the OUTPUT A/B button on the front panel 
switches the multiplexer video output. When OUTPUT A is 
selected, the button light indicator is off. When OUTPUT 
B is selected, the button light indicator is on, and the 
buttons related to playback function are operated for the 
monitor screen connected to the OUTPUT B connector. 
Pressing the OUTPUT A/B button again switches the 
multiplexer output to OUTPUT A.
 The playback of each camera may not be executed at a 
constant speed depending on the recorded condition.
 During the split screen display, the playback speed may 
be slower than the speed used for recording.
 When playing back on both OUTPUT A and B, the 
playback speed may be affected and become slower.
